triller
Meanings
noun
- A small passerine bird of the genus Lalage belonging to the cuckooshrike family Campephagidae, so called because of the loud trilling calls of the male birds.
- One who or that which trills.
- A musical ornament consisting of a rapid alternation between two adjacent notes.
Word forms
Etymology
From trill + -er.
